Gallium-Modified Zinc Oxide Thin Films Prepared by Chemical Solution Deposition

Gallium-doped ZnO (GZO) thin films on glass, which can be used as transparent electrodes, were prepared using a spin coating technique. Thermal analysis and Fourier-transform infrared spectroscopy of the dried precursor solution Zn acetate Ga nitrate dissolved in ethanol with diethanolamine confirmed decomposition organic components upon heating formation at 450 °C.
